What the One Piece Card Game is

The One Piece Card Game is Bandai's card game adaptation of Eiichiro Oda's manga and anime, launched in Japan and English simultaneously in 2022. It runs on a leader-and-life system rather than the deck-and-hand-size format most Western players know from Magic or Pokémon: each deck is built around a single Leader card that stays in play the whole game, and life is tracked as a face-down stack drawn from when you take damage rather than a number on a die. Bandai releases a new numbered booster roughly every two to three months, and the game has grown quickly into one of the most actively traded TCGs outside the Pokémon–Magic–Yu-Gi-Oh triumvirate.

OP-14: The Azure Sea's Seven

OP-14 released in Japan on 22 November 2025 and in English on 16 January 2026, themed around the Seven Warlords of the Sea — one of the Three Great Powers that keep an uneasy balance across the world of One Piece. The set introduces seven new Leader cards built around individual Warlords: Trafalgar Law on a Supernovas/Heart Pirates theme, Dracule Mihawk on the World's Greatest Swordsman, Jinbe on Fish-Man and Sun Pirates synergies, Boa Hancock built around Triggers, Donquixote Doflamingo on a defensive control theme, Crocodile on cost reduction, and Gecko Moria combining power boosts with life-gain. The headline chase card is the Dracule Mihawk Manga Rare — a monochrome illustration built from original manga panels — alongside a Crocodile Secret Rare, both built around genuinely strong late-game effects rather than being pure collector pulls.

Booster box vs. booster pack

OP-14 is sold as single 12-card booster packs or a 24-pack booster box, the standard split for the line. A box guarantees the full, disclosed pack count in one sealed unit — useful for anyone drafting or building toward a specific Leader — while packs let a buyer try the set or chase one card without the box outlay.
